The Flor Del Todo isn’t an expensive cigar at all. In fact its the first cigar under $1 that I’ve smoked. You can pick up a bundle of 40 Flor Del Todos at Cigars International for $39.05. Other places have them for even less. You do the math on that one.

I picked up a Cusano18 at a local cigar shop about 20 minutes away. The owner recommened it as a good “cheap” cigar. You can grab one for about $5.50 at cigar.com; I picked mine up locally for a dollar and a half cheaper.
